Jeff Lemire and Dustin Nguyen reunite for a new ongoing dark fantasy series from Image Comics called Crowbound.
Crowbound begins when a distraught mother makes a dangerous pact with an ancient Scarecrow Queen to stop the government from taking her daughter.
“Crowbound is the darkest book Dustin and I have done together but still filled with heart and hope,” said Lemire. “It’s been rewarding building the expansive southern gothic sci-fi world of Crowbound and we can’t wait to unleash it on readers.”
Nguyen said, “I’m very excited to explore this new world and new ways to tell a story with Jeff again, it’s always a great time when we get together like this. Hope everyone joins us for the adventures as they did on Descender and Little Monsters.”

Crowbound #1 will be available at your local comic book shop on September 2.
